Beth-ar'abah. (house of the desert). One of the six cities of Judah, which were situated down in the Arabah, the sunk valley of the Jordan and Dead Sea, Joshua 15:61, on the north border of the tribe. It is also included in the list of the towns of Benjamin. Joshua 18:22.
